They are now recruiting for a Mobile Air Conditioning Maintenance Engineer, ideally with a facilities maintenance background. JOB RESPONSIBILITIES Perform planned preventative maintenance (PPM) and reactive maintenance on air conditioning systems, including VRV/VRF, split systems, and AHUs. Diagnose and repair faults in HVAC systems to ensure optimal performance and energy efficiency.
Conduct system inspections, pressure testing, and leak detection in accordance with F-Gas regulations. Work on electrical systems related to HVAC units, including control panels, wiring, and fault-finding. Maintain compliance with health and safety regulations, ensuring all work meets industry standards. Provide excellent customer service while liaising with clients, site managers, and contractors. Keep detailed service records and complete job reports promptly.
Maintenance, repairs and all general Air Conditioning duties, including being able to assist with mechanical & plumbing works if required on site. Design & installation, after care service and maintenance of commercial refrigeration and air conditioning systems carrying out the service and maintenance of a multitude of equipment ranging from commercial equipment including cold rooms, ice machines, VRV & VRF Indoor and Outdoor Units, Heat Recovery Units, leak testing systems etc.
QUALIFICATIONS/EXPERIENCE City & Guilds Level 2 (minimum) City & Guilds Level 3 in Refrigeration/Air Conditioning (preferred) F-Gas & ODS Regulations (C&G 2079-11) - Minimum requirement. 18th Edition - Desirable Candidate who can assist with electrical PPM tasks including emergency lighting tests and small repairs would be desirable Experience in Air Source Heat Pumps would be desirable and additional training on this can be provided.
Knowledge of M&E building services. Knowledge of HVAC plant i.e. A/C, boilers, controls, heating and cooling systems, ventilation. Understanding of overall Health & Safety.
